Being challenged

Being pushed out of my comfort zone is not something I relish often. I’ll throw myself into a challenge like silks, pole dancing or surfboat rowing because ultimately I know, somewhere deep down, that I’m capable of it at least up to a point.

This term at silks has seen me hitting one of those points. Normally, each term in the last class of the term, we do a routine or performance for each other. This term our teacher is very focussed on our “performance” skills, ie the presentation, character and narrative if we have one. I’ve never done drama or performance so it’s really quite confronting to let go of your hangups about embarrassing yourself and just let loose. Tonight is half way though the term and we did a work-in-progress routine. Last week, talking through my reservations etc with my teacher she looked at my routine, which was trick trick trick trick trick and not performance or character, and she told me you are allowed one trick and the rest has to be performance.

I nearly shit my pants. My piece of music is 4:45 minutes long and I had to basically improvise. Apparently I did quite well, the class was enthusiastic and complimentary so I’m feeling like there’s been a breakthrough of sorts. Now to put a more simple routine together with some performance for week 9.
